Transaction aee21de63d3103b869dea6f97e621d547e789a2ec15a34b8d9b5c5c7c6918914
1 Input
1 Output
-
aee21de63d3103b869dea6f97e621d547e789a2ec15a34b8d9b5c5c7c6918914:0
- value
- 425849
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fa22315f30e60b0c8be70b008b8bb1ce53aac40
- address
- bc1qr73zx90npestpj97wzcq3w9mrnjn4tzq55cyq4